Nelson Mandela’s top 10 apps

mandela-mural-2-350x262As the world mourns the passing of former South African President Nelson Mandela, with a memorial service of global significance scheduled for 10 December 2013 at Johannesburg’s FNB Stadium, there are a number of mobile applications that share the legacy and history of the iconic statesman. IT News Africa compiled a list of apps that capture the great man’s life and history.

1. Honor Nelson Mandela

Users who download this app will be able to light a candle to remember and respect Nelson Mandela, the anti-apartheid icon, winner of the Nobel Peace Prize and the father of South-Africa. “See a different Nelson Mandela quote every time you light a candle, read memories about Mandela and send a greeting yourself. Includes the life story of Mandela,” the description of the app reads. There are two versions available, a free one and a paid version, which will cost $1. Developed by Teemu Kuusimurto, it is available for iPhone, iPad and iPod Touch.

2. Nelson Mandela Quotes

Developed by The Greatest Of All Time, this app is the essential guide of Nelson Mandela quotes. This new HD version features images and a new designed user interface with break up images. All pictures with quotes can be saved as wallpapers with high quality and high definition, and all pictures are saved offline, so there is no need to be connected to the internet in order for the quotes to refresh.

3. Nelson Mandela (history)

For users who would like to read up more about the iconic statesman, this app is a one-stop shop for all information relating to his life. Developed by n-frames Technologies Ltd. for Android devices, the offering features a biography, pictures, videos and quotes. “Not only can you get them in one place, you can share all your favourites with your friends in a click,” the developer explains. Including Mandela, the developer has also released apps for other prominent people such as Charlie Chaplin, Warren Buffet and Walt Disney.

4. Nelson Mandela (general information)

Another app with great information regarding Mandela, this educational app developed by Triple Bottom Line, LLC. “Nelson Mandela became South Africa’s first black president in 1994, following a 20-year anti-apartheid campaign,” the app states in their description. A highly-detailed biography providing users with relevant and up-to-date information is included.

5. Nelson Mandela Quiz

For those users who would like to test their knowledge of Mandela, this app – developed by 101Apps – is a free, multiple choice style quiz. “The questions cover the life and times of the well-known and liked South African Statesman, Nelson Mandela. The app ships with 50 questions and you can download an additional 50 questions from the developer’s website for free,” the developer states. Users will be able to select how many questions they would like to answer per session, and the questions are randomly selected and displayed along with five possible answers. The answers are displayed in random order.

6. Mandela’s Family

Developed for Microsoft’s Windows Phone operating system, the app features a detailed view of Mandela’s family – specifically his wives, children and grandchildren. It is a great historical source for historians or anybody who is interested in his clan, his family and his ancestral history – dating back many years.

7. History Timeline: Mandela

Sticking to a historical theme, the History Timeline: Mandela app is a great resource for history buffs. Also developed for Microsoft’s Windows Phone operating system, by Mpondo Ndamase, the app features a timeline of events that marked the life of this legendary South African political icon.  The developer has also created an app that chronicles the history of South Africa called the History Timeline: South Africa app.

8. Life of Nelson Mandela

“He was the first black South African to hold the office, and the first elected in a fully representative, multiracial election. His government focused on dismantling the legacy of apartheid through tackling institutionalised racism, poverty and inequality, and fostering racial reconciliation,” the app states in their description. Just as the title states, the app briefly describes his personal life, achievements and includes a photo gallery. Developed by Naresh Kumar M, the educational app is made available for Microsoft’s Windows Phone operating system.

9. Mandela Project

“Nelson Mandela’s extraordinary life and legacy demonstrate that we each have the capacity to make a positive difference in the world,” states founders Ndaba and Kweku Mandela. The project, with its accompanying website and app, lets users join the developers to help build a movement honouring Mandela’s legacy. “Share your inspiration with the Mandela family and community on Mandela Project. Be the change you wish to see in the world,” the app reads.

10. Nelson Mandela Smart TV app

The Nelson Mandela Centre of Memory, in partnership with Samsung, wanted to produce an Android Application that would be engaging and provide information on the life of Nelson Mandela. Developed by Cytrus, the application displays content from the current Nelson Mandela Foundation website, key focus points for the app are an interactive Timeline, On this Day, News and Social Sharing. The Timeline displays historical events in Nelson Mandela’s life using social sharing, images, video and facts.
